Bomb blasts kill five in Assam

Nalbari, (Assam), Nov 22 (ANI): Just four days before the first anniversary of the 26/11 terror attacks, bomb blasts in Assam claimed the lives of five people and injured about 30.

All the three-bomb blast took place in Assam’s Nalbari District.

At around 10.30 in the morning two of the explosions occurred outside a police station in Nalbari, which is around 70 kilometers from Guwahati.

A third bomb blast took place in the Gopal Bazar area.

Further details are awaited. No outfit has claimed responsibility for the blast. (ANI)
